Turn a few simple ingredients into a rich, cheesy chicken dinner that’s packed with flavor and family-approved! This upgraded bake features juicy chicken smothered in a herb-spiked sour cream sauce, topped with gooey mozzarella and golden Parmesan.
6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
6 slices mozzarella cheese
1½ cups sour cream
¾ cup grated Parmesan cheese (not powdered)
½ cup additional Parmesan cheese (for topping)
1½ tbsp cornstarch
1½ tsp dried oregano
1½ tsp dried basil
1½ tsp garlic powder
¾ tsp salt
¾ tsp freshly ground black pepper
Chopped parsley, for garnish
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ly grease a large baking dish.
In a bowl, combine sour cream, ¾ cup Parmesan, cornstarch, and all seasonings.
Arrange chicken breasts in the baking dish and spread the sour cream mixture generously over each.
Top each with a mozzarella slice, then sprinkle with the remaining ½ cup Parmesan.
Bake uncovered for 35–45 minutes, until the chicken is fully cooked and the cheese is bubbly and golden.
Garnish with chopped parsley before serving.
Storage: Refrigerate leftovers up to 3 days
